After ePayments, DSX announced that all of their bank operations are suspended till unkown.

As you might have heard, ePayments has been reviewed by the FCA and agreed to temporarily suspend all accounts.

We are also temporarily facing some issues with our banking suppliers due to this situation.

As such, we are temporarily unable to accept bank deposits or process bank withdrawals. We are already working hard with the bank to fix the issue and start processing bank transfers again. However, cryptocurrency transfes are working as usual.

As soon as we have an update we will let you know.

We apologise for any inconvenience caused and want to assure you that the DSX team is working tirelessly to provide you with deposit and withdrawal options as soon as possible.

DSX sent another update just now. Looks like they found a new bank and all bank operations are back to normal.

We’re working tirelessly to provide you with the best crypto experience you deserve.

Today we’ve managed to:


  1. Get a new banking relationship. Look for the new bank account details we are ready to start accepting deposits.
  2. Team is making necessary changes to the infrastructure to get the withdrawals moving.
  3. Card deposits are back online. Visa is available globally, Mastercard (EU, Russia, Ukraine, Mexico and South Africa) for now. More countries to come soon.
  4. Getting ready to enable debit/credit cards withdrawals.
